Abu Dhabi Unveils AED 240 Billion Infrastructure Plan
In one of the largest public investment announcements in recent years, Abu Dhabi confirmed an AED 240 billion infrastructure programme dedicated to roads, mobility, utilities, and coastal expansion.
What this means for residents
Faster mobility between Saadiyat, Yas and mainland districts
Reinforced coastline for long-term climate resilience
Improved access roads to cultural hubs and event venues
Better public transport connectivity around festival zones

New Abu Dhabi Finance Cluster Announced - 8,000 Jobs by 2045
The capital launched a dedicated financial zone designed to attract investment houses, fintech firms and global asset managers. The cluster aims to create 8,000 jobs and expand Abu Dhabi’s footprint as a regional financial hub.
Highlights
Talent development pathways for UAE nationals
Regulatory incentives for multinational firms
Accelerator programmes for fintech startups

Driverless Mercedes-Benz Taxis to Launch in 2026

Abu Dhabi is officially preparing to introduce fully autonomous Mercedes-Benz taxis, placing the capital among the first global cities to move toward Level 4+ mobility.
Rollout will include
Controlled trial zones
High-definition roadway mapping
Remote safety supervision

Hudayriyat Island Development Sells Out - AED 3 Billion Raised
Modon Properties confirmed its latest Hudayriyat project sold out within 24 hours, raising AED 3 billion and signalling intense investor interest in coastal living.
